For the Oklahoma City Thunder to have a chance against the defending champion Golden State Warriors, they are going to need contributions past Kevin Durant and Russell Westbrook.
You all know what that means.
Dion Waiters.
Against the Warriors bench units, Dion will need to fill in for one of the superstars while they rest. And for the most part, Waiters has answered the call thus far in Game 1. In the first half, Dion shot 2-4 from the field and added three assists as well.
One of those dimes was a beauty. Dion led a three-on-two break against Andre Iguodala and Harrison Barnes defending. Waiters dribbled in, and as the Warriors defenders collapsed, threw a gorgeous pass behind his head to Serge Ibaka for the dunk.
